无论你是初学者还是资深DBA,掌握PostgreSQL的安装与配置都是一项必备技能。本文,AI部落将带你从零开始,一步步搭建完美的PostgreSQL运行环境。
第一步:选择操作系统与版本
PostgreSQL支持Windows、Linux、macOS等主流操作系统。对于生产环境,推荐使用Ubuntu 20.04/22.04 LTS或CentOS 7/8等长期支持版本。本文以Ubuntu 22.04为例进行演示。
第二步:安装PostgreSQL
使用官方APT仓库安装(Ubuntu/Debian)
Windows与macOS安装
Windows用户可从官网下载安装程序,按向导完成安装;macOS用户推荐使用Homebrew:brew install postgresql@16。
第三步:初始化与启动服务
Ubuntu安装完成后,系统会自动创建postgres用户和数据库集群。使用以下命令管理服务:
第四步:配置访问与认证
PostgreSQL默认只允许本地连接。修改/etc/postgresql/16/main/postgresql.conf中的listen_addresses = '*',并在pg_hba.conf中添加客户端认证规则。完成后重启服务。
第五步:创建数据库与用户
第六步:测试与验证
至此,一个可用的PostgreSQL数据库环境已经搭建完成。
让数据库部署更简单:PetaCloud的云上实践
尽管本地安装步骤清晰,但在实际业务场景中,手动维护数据库服务器仍然面临着硬件采购、系统补丁、备份恢复、高可用架构等诸多复杂挑战。这正是PetaCloud发挥价值的场景——作为提供稳定、高性价比全球云服务的平台,PetaCloud可以让你在几分钟内完成PostgreSQL云数据库的部署,彻底消除底层技术的复杂性。
通过PetaCloud的控制台,你无需手动执行上述安装命令,无需操心操作系统的兼容性问题,更无需关注数据盘的RAID配置。PetaCloud提供一键式的数据库实例创建、自动备份、监控告警和弹性伸缩能力,同时支持多地域部署,助力业务快速增长。
结语
从零开始手动安装PostgreSQL是理解数据库运行机制的良好实践,而将生产环境托付给专业的云服务商则是效率与稳定性的明智选择。希望本文的详细步骤能帮助你快速上手PostgreSQL,也欢迎体验PetaCloud带来的便捷云数据库服务。
AI部落温馨提示:以上是对PostgreSQL安装步骤详解:从零开始打造完美环境的介绍,点击PetaCloud官网,了解PetaCloud虚拟机,释放云计算无线可能!
本文由网上采集发布,不代表我们立场,转载联系作者并注明出处:https://www.aijto.com/12477.html






